Hi! My name is Suetmui (“Suit-moi”) Yu, and I am a junior majoring in Physiology at The University of Arizona. I joined Dr. Ningning Zhao’s lab at the beginning of the Spring 2021 semester. Since then, I have been working in the Zhao lab to study the metabolism and homeostatic regulation of manganese–a nutrient that is essential for life. My current project involves using an animal model to understand how changing the levels of manganese intake might alter the expression of a manganese transport protein in the body. Results from this project may give a better understanding of this protein’s function and how a defect in this protein leads to dysregulated manganese metabolism.
